What is the difference between Assistant Country Director vs Program Manager?

AspectAssistant Country DirectorProgram Manager
CredentialsTypically requires a master's degree in development, management, or related field; extensive experience in program coordinationUsually holds a bachelor's or master's degree; experience in project management or sector-specific expertise
Work EnvironmentWorks closely with senior leadership, oversees multiple programs, and supports strategic planningFocuses on managing specific projects or programs, ensuring implementation and reporting
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in NGOs, international agencies, and development organizationsWidely used across NGOs, government agencies, and private sector projects

The Assistant Country Director and Program Manager roles both operate within development and NGO sectors, but the Assistant Country Director holds a broader leadership position with strategic responsibilities, while the Program Manager focuses on specific project execution. Both roles require relevant experience and credentials, but the Assistant Country Director typically has a higher level of seniority and oversight.

What is the role of the assistant country director?

The assistant country director supports the country director in managing program implementation, overseeing staff, and ensuring project goals are met. They often handle administrative tasks, coordinate with partners, and may step in for the director when needed to ensure smooth operations within the organization.

Job description

Make an impact. Change lives. Live a Legacy.
As a Rehab Director with Legacy Healthcare Services, you serve as the primary Legacy representative at the facility, promoting Legacy policies, clinical programs and supporting our mission to help aging adults live safe, healthy lives full of strength, movement, and joy. Whether you're a Physical Therapist, Occupational Therapist, Physical Therapist Assistant, Speech Language Pathologist, or Certified Occupational Therapy Assistant, this is your opportunity to grow as a leader while making a lasting impact every day.
As a Rehab Director, you'll have the opportunity to:
  • Create rapport and positive working relationships with key facility personnel and fellow Legacy employees that allows for discovery of others' needs.
  • Oversee internal marketing efforts to assist with relationship building with staff and residents while keeping community leaders apprised of Legacy's programs and other offerings.
  • Manage site productivity and makes necessary changes to achieve budget.
  • Maintain a caseload that assists the rehab department in meeting standards.
  • Able to assess patient needs and develop clinical programs appropriate for the facility census.
  • Able to direct and train others in clinical service delivery across disciplines.
  • Daily coordination of rehab department with facility staff to plan and implement therapy programming.
  • Participates in clinical outcomes reporting and shares with the customer.
  • Manages staff schedules to meet the caseload requirements and utilizes the scheduling tools for patient schedules.
  • Manages CliniFax and all requirements of physician signatures on the therapy plan of cares.
  • Creates and maintains team relationships and open communication with and between rehab staff, facility staff, and Legacy corporate personnel.
  • Assists with orientation/training for staff with guidance and assistance from ARD/ MSM to meet company, state and federal standards.
